Doors are bulky, made in specific sizes and finishes, and most of ours are built for the opening you measured. That shapes what can come back and what cannot. Here it is in plain terms.

The short version. Stock doors can be returned within 30 days, unopened and unused, with a 25% restocking charge. Special orders and anything cut, pre-hung or altered for you cannot be returned. Damage in transit is a separate matter — tell us within 48 hours and we replace it at no cost to you.

What can be returned

A stock door that is still in its original packaging, unused and undamaged, within 30 days of the date you received it. Every return has to be authorized by us in writing before it comes back; goods sent back without authorization cannot be credited.

Returned items are inspected at the warehouse before a credit is issued, and you need to be able to show proof of purchase.

Restocking and shipping costs

Authorized returns carry a 25% restocking charge on the invoice price. The original delivery charge is not refunded, and the cost of getting the goods back to us is yours unless the return is our error or a manufacturing defect.

How to return something

  1. Call (480) 748-0296 or email [email protected] with your order number and what you want to return.
  2. We confirm in writing whether the item qualifies, and give you a return authorization.
  3. Bring the item to the showroom, or arrange collection with us.
  4. After inspection we issue the credit to the card you paid with, less the restocking charge. Allow a few business days for it to appear on the statement.

Cancelling an order

You can cancel a stock order any time before it is dispatched, at no cost. A special order can be cancelled only before manufacturing begins; once production has started, the order is firm, and any material and production costs already incurred are payable. The same applies to changes made after an order is placed.

Damaged or defective on arrival

This is not a return, and none of the charges above apply.

Inspect each item at delivery, before signing, and note any visible damage on the delivery paperwork. Open the boxes: concealed damage counts too. Report it to us within 48 hours of delivery, with photos of the item and its packaging. We arrange a replacement or a repair.

Damage found once installation has begun cannot be accepted — checking condition before installing is what the inspection is for.

Manufacturing defects later on

Doors carry the manufacturer's limited two-year warranty from the date of delivery, covering defects in materials and workmanship. Send us photos and your order number and we will file the claim. Normal wear, moisture damage, misuse, and faults caused by installation done by others are not covered — the full terms are on the Terms of Sale page.
